Information on healthy aging and strength

Regular participation in muscle strengthening activities are associated with observable health and fitness benefits. Besides to improving physical function and psychological well-being, A growing body of evidence links strength training to longevity. That is, engaging in strength-building activities throughout life can help adults live longer and live healthier. Instead of focusing only on the concept of lifespan, which simply referred to quantity of the years we have lived, we should think about its construction “force», which emphasizes quality of life in terms of physical strength and functionality. A bigger force means that a person can not only live longer, but May also be able to perform daily tasks independently and recreational activities skillfully as they age.

By definition, force refers to a quantitative measurement of physical strength, such as grip strength or maximum strength repetition in a lifetime. This term not only recognizes the importance of building and maintaining a reserve of muscular strength early life, but also includes the ability to operation independently and drive safely. Its construction force promotes the idea that maintaining Physical strength is essential for maintaining mobility and building resilience against age-related declines in muscle function. While individual responses to strength training may varyadults of any age can make significant improvements in strength and function ability with consistent participation in muscle strengthening activities that are individualized to their needs and abilities. The figure depicts life course trajectories for hypotheticals force curves for (A) optimal strength development, improved health and longer lifespan and (B) suboptimal strength development, poor health and shorter lifespan.

Unfortunately, the number of adults who regularly participate in muscle strengthening activities falls far short of expectations. Data from National Health Interview Survey I establish that only about 7% of adults in the United States meet physical activity guidelines for muscle-strengthening activities. Consequently, too many adults they don’t build and maintaining a reserve of muscle power that will allow them to stay active as they age. If health and exercise Professionals aiming to promote healthy aging must recognize the importance of extending it force from early years to later years to reduce the rate and size decrease in muscle strength. No exercise interventions that include muscle-strengthening activities, the loss of muscle strength will accelerate, the ability to perform physical tasks will decrease and the quality of life will decrease, further worsening feelings of inadequacy and isolation.
